Watercolor for enamel on copper covered box with yellow dandelion decoration in two views, side by side. View on left is of covered box from above; view on right is of covered box from side angle. Each view is of yellowish-gold dandelions with large green leaves on dark blue box.
"sg 273" penciled in above designs along upper edge. Since the conception of the enamel department in 1898, nearly all Tiffany enamels were labeled EL or SG and numbered sequentially. "SG" stands for the Stourbridge Glass Company.

In 1898 an enameling department was set up as part of the Stourbridge Glass Company; in 1902, it was renamed Tiffany Furnaces.
